Absolutely not those 2; unless you mean "the 2nd Hampton show". Because those 2 shows make a LOT more sense for Rolling Stones to give to Eagle Vision, as a part of their contract with them. No sense in releasing audio of only of something which is filmed in such a great way


BTW - since Rolling Stones, the last 2-3 years, no longer is interested in "holding back" the golden days for us; by releasing L&G, Texas 78 and Brussels 73, and in other words are not afraid of looking at their live-catalogue objectively and from a sane point of view, I think they KNOW that releasing a late 90s or 2000s show would disappoint people, and people just wouldn't be buying a release of....let's say Atlantic City 2006. If there ever will be a "after 1982" show in these series, my bet is that it will be one of the club gigs of 1995, since those ones have a quite high rank among most "fans"
....though....it also makes sense for them to release these shows on Eagle Vision, since there exists great PRO shot footage of them.

Re: The Department of Historical Accuracy
Posted by: with sssoul ()
Date: January 24, 2012 01:03

Bill joined the band in the autumn of 62, not the same day as Charlie.
Charlie did indeed join in january 63 but most sources give the date as january 12th
